Entah bagaimana saya mendapat server 12,04 untuk berhenti memperbarui kernel. Itu macet di 3.2.0-24-generic dan tidak ingin mengambil pembaruan baru. Kernel baru saat ini adalah 3.2.0-29
apt-get clean && sudo apt-get autoremove
apt-get -f install
apt-get update
apt-get dist-upgrade
Menunjukkan “0 ditingkatkan, 0 baru dipasang, 0 untuk dihapus dan 0 tidak ditingkatkan.” Tidak ada pemasangan yang gagal. /var/log/aptitude tidak menunjukkan kesalahan
Daftar sumber saya:
###### Ubuntu Main Repos
deb http://ca.archive.ubuntu.com/ubuntu/ precise main restricted
deb-src http://ca.archive.ubuntu.com/ubuntu/ precise main restricted
###### Ubuntu Update Repos
deb http://ca.archive.ubuntu.com/ubuntu/ precise-security main restricted
deb http://ca.archive.ubuntu.com/ubuntu/ precise-updates main restricted
deb-src http://ca.archive.ubuntu.com/ubuntu/ precise-security main restricted
deb-src http://ca.archive.ubuntu.com/ubuntu/ precise-updates main restricted
###### Ubuntu Partner Repo
deb http://archive.canonical.com/ubuntu precise partner
deb-src http://archive.canonical.com/ubuntu precise partner
Ada yang tahu ada apa?
Terima kasih
Jawaban Terbaik
Anda mungkin telah menghapus linux
metapackage secara tidak sengaja. Jika demikian, itu harus diperbaiki dengan:
sudo apt-get install linux
Penjelasan lebih lanjut:
Karena alasan teknis, tidak bijaksana jika kernel diupgrade dan diganti dengan yang baru (misalnya jika yang baru gagal, Anda masih bisa boot ke yang lama).
Jadi kernel dikemas dengan nama seperti linux-image-3.2.0-24-generic
.
Jadi, jika Anda memutakhirkan sistem, secara teknis tidak ada pembaruan untuk versi ini! Kecuali Anda menginstal linux
metapackage yang selalu bergantung pada kernel terbaru, artinya setiap kali pembaruan kernel tersedia, linux
akan mengubah versi, dan itu akan tergantung pada kernel yang lebih baru, dan dengan demikian kernel baru akan diinstal secara otomatis.
Ingatlah bahwa kernel lama Anda tidak akan dihapus dengan cara ini, yang merupakan hal yang baik. Jika Anda menemukan sesuatu yang aneh, Anda dapat mem-boot ke yang lama (grub -> Versi sebelumnya atau semacamnya) dan menghapus kernel baru.